I've been thinking about this a lot lately, as I'm finishing up putting a boost controller, knock controller, AFR and fuel pressure gauges on my car.

I think many of the people bidding to high levels on the 930s on BaT are new buyers that haven't owned / researched a 930.

Chris from TurboKraft posted once that the overboost switches he's tested, brand new from Porsche didn't work right / were out of spec.

So to someone who has done their research, a car with all the bugs worked out, that runs great and has safeties on it like knock control, boost solenoid cutoff for lean AFR, etc makes sense. Those are great upgrades.

But to people who have never really researched these cars (including me 2 years ago when I bought mine :rolleyes:) a bunch of non-stock looking gauges and non-factory wiring looks like a non-Porsche approved mess.

I think the market bidding these cars up is in love with the look of the 930 and the idea of it, hyper focused on it "being original", and not necessarily the reality of the way these engines really were from the factory.
